SRK to gift his bodyguard a flat

Shahrukh Khan has decided to gift his bodyguard Yaseen Khan a flat as a wedding gift. Yaseen has been staying at Shahrukh's Mannat ever since he had started working with him. But now when he is getting married, he is finding little awkward to stay at Shahrukh's house with his newly wedded. Understanding his uneasiness, King Khan has decided to gift Yaseen a falt who hails from Karnataka.

Says a source, "Ever since he began working with SRK over a decade ago, he has been traveling with the actor wherever he goes, including his overseas shoots. But  a single guy living under his roof is quite different from someone who has a wife and wants to start a family. And so,when he told SRK that he was tying the knot, it was clear to both that he'd need a new place. That's when SRK decided to present his most trusted guy a wedding gift he would remember."

Shahrukh did like him to stay nearby his house and so he will go for a flat somewhere at Bandra. Yaseen who is on a short visit to his hometown will join Shahrukh in New York where he is shooting for 'My Name Is Khan'.

'Every Damn Time,' Tweets Shah Rukh Khan, Detained At US Airport

Movie star Shah Rukh Khan, detained at an airport in the US for questioning again, tweeted on Thursday: "Every damn time!" The 50-year-old actor was detained at the Los Angeles airport this time. A man with the same name is on a US no-fly list of 80,000 people. He took to Twitter to voice his exasperation. I fully understand & respect security with the way the world is, but to be detained at US immigration every damn time really really sucks. @iamsrk  The brighter side is while waiting caught some really nice Pokemons. @iamsrk  Mr Khan, one of the most successful stars in the Hindi film industry, has been held back at US airports thrice in seven years. American officials tell NDTV that during immigration checks, what pops up is a name without any other detail to help draw a distinction.
